That plus-minus disparity is due to how poorly Green started the Dallas series, dragging his overall plus-minus to a 5.6. Over the last nine games (since Game Five against Dallas where Green seemed to find his shot), Danny's average plus-minus is about 11.4 while Leonard's is about 9.9. Obviously, last night was a big outlier in Danny's favor, and without it, Green has a 9.1 and Kawhi has a 9.6.

That's all a fancy way of saying Danny and Kawhi have both been really impactful since the middle of the Dallas series.

Danny Green proved to be a shutdown defender for the San Antonio Spurs.

The Thunder missed 14 of 16 shots from the field and committed three turnovers in situations in which Green was the primary defender. Russell Westbrook and Kevin Durant were a combined 2-for-9 when guarded by Green.

Green had held opponents to 42 percent shooting from the field in the first two rounds.

The Spurs outscored the Thunder by 30 points in Green’s 27 minutes on the floor.
